And providing the best possible workplace for our employees gives us a competitive advantage-helping us attract and retain top talent and drive better business results.ResponsibilitiesThe following duties are typical of the position but are not all encompassing. Responsibilities include those required to deliver quality service on schedule and within budget in a team environment.

Models Mechanical elements in Revit and develops construction documents and drawings.

Applies standard design techniques and procedures exercising judgment in making minor adaptations and modifications to design concepts.

Receives instructions on specific assignment objectives, complex features, and assistance in deriving possible solutions to unusual problems.

Provides technical leadership, guidance, mentoring, and support to project engineering staff

Coordinates and directs the work effort of designers on the same project with some responsibility for checking portions of the completed drawings.

Attends construction meetings and produces site observation reports and final punch list. May trouble-shoot design problems in the field during construction.

Develops an understanding for other discipline's needs and requirements and relates them to own discipline and total project scope.

Researches design options and documents findings for project engineer/architect.

Checks design calculations and drawings.

Processes shop drawings; checks to ensure quality accuracy and completeness.

Has occasional external customer contact.

May be requested to attend training to develop supervisory skills.

May serve as job captain on single discipline projects.

May write portions of specifications and assist in preparing design and construction cost estimates.

Travel required.QualificationsAssociate degree or certification of completion of other post secondary training in mechnical engineering preferred.

Minimum nineteen (19) years experience with former employer(s).

Extensive piping experience and strong knowledge of modeling valves, strainers, and other components in a Utility Building/Mechanical Room.

Pipe Spooling experience is a plus.

Valid driver's license required. May be waived for international assignments.

Salary Range: $85,000-$105,000/year depending on location, education, experience, and any certifications that are directly related to the position.

Benefits include health, dental and vision insurance, life insurance, 401K, PTO & paid holidays.
